## Quarterly Stock-Count Ledger — Transfer Procedure

The Q3 stock-count ledger for the Merrowfield warehouse travels by bonded courier from the Dalwick counting office every quarter-end. The ledger is bound, wax-sealed, and logged in the outbound register before departure. On arrival, verify the seal is intact, record the time in the receiving book, and store the ledger in the fireproof cabinet pending audit. Release will not occur until the receiving clerk states the agreed confirmation phrase to the courier.

handover note for bajog-tawig: the lamion quenael courier leaves the wendor ledger at gate 1289 under passcode 760784

## Service Accounts — Crashlane Pipeline

The Crashlane pipeline ingests crash reports from the Fernwick mobile app, symbolicates them, and forwards grouped issues to triage. Each stage runs under a dedicated service account with least-privilege scopes; none of these accounts may be used interactively. New team members configure the ingestion worker first, since everything downstream depends on it. Its service account authenticates with the key below.

gateway credential: kto7_GoY89Me

### Changed

Renamed the offline cache toggle for the Fieldlark survey app from the legacy name used in v2 to the new, clearer one introduced in v3.1. The old name is still read as a fallback but logs a deprecation warning; please migrate any env files you touch during onboarding. Behavior is otherwise identical: queued survey responses persist locally until sync. After the rename, the offline sync credential must directly follow this entry's sample line.

vault entry, yahif-yajep: COURIER_KEY29=b802bdf8034096b65a51c6ba5abe2